How to Set Up a Sportsbook

A sportsbook is a gambling establishment that accepts bets on sporting events and games. It offers a wide variety of betting options, from traditional bets on teams to prop bets on individual players. Regardless of the type of bet, all bets have a common element: risk-reward. The higher the risk, the greater the reward if the bet is successful. Choosing the right sportsbook will require some research on the part of the bettor, but it is important to find one that treats its customers fairly and pays out winnings promptly.

There are many different types of sports betting, and each has its own rules and regulations. For example, some states only allow sports betting through licensed casinos, while others have no restrictions. In general, the main goal of a sportsbook is to increase revenue by attracting and retaining users. A great way to do this is by offering rewards and providing a user-friendly interface.

In addition, a good sportsbook will offer a variety of betting lines and markets. This allows bettors to make informed decisions about which bets to place. In order to maximize profits, sportsbooks must set their odds based on the probability of an event occurring. These odds are typically expressed as positive (+) or negative (-). The most popular U.S.-based sportsbooks use positive (+) odds to indicate how much you can win if you bet $100, and negative (-) odds to show how much you need to wager in order to win $100.

The first step in setting up a sportsbook is to determine the rules and regulations of your local jurisdiction. This will help ensure that your business is legal and secure. In addition, it is important to be aware of any restrictions on underage gambling and money laundering. In most cases, you will need to register your sportsbook with the appropriate gaming commission.

There are also a number of other elements to consider when developing a sportsbook. For example, you should make sure that your website is mobile-friendly and that it offers a variety of payment methods. You should also focus on improving your user experience by offering a fast and easy registration process. Finally, you should include a reward system to encourage users to keep coming back to your site.

While it is tempting to choose a turnkey solution for your sportsbook, this can be costly and limit your control. Furthermore, it may not be as scalable as a custom solution. Moreover, these solutions typically charge a fixed monthly operational fee which can take a large chunk out of your profit margins. This is why it is always better to build a custom sportsbook from the ground up with a professional software development team like CrustLab. This will allow you to create a product that is both high quality and scalable. In addition, a custom solution will allow you to integrate a range of value-added services that can help your users make informed decisions and improve their betting experience.